## Changelog — Ticktrace 1.9

### Renamed: DRIFT_API_TOKEN
During the cron drift investigation we found plugins confusing this variable with the metrics token, so it has been renamed to indicate it authorizes drift-report uploads specifically. Plugin authors must read the new name from 1.9 onward; the old name is ignored without warning. Sample env files in the SDK are updated. In your deployment env file, the drift-report upload secret is set on the next line.

env line for fawef-taguf: VAULT_KEY13=a9695905a9a90

## StockMend Environment Variables

Plugin authors extending the StockMend inventory reconciliation job must configure their sandbox carefully. The job compares warehouse counts against ledger snapshots every four hours, and plugins receive a read-only delta feed. Set STOCKMEND_FEED_MODE to `delta` and STOCKMEND_BATCH_SIZE to a value under 500 to avoid throttling. All variables live in the plugin's `.env` file, loaded before the reconciliation pass begins. The feed endpoint also requires an access credential on the next line.

env line for fafof-fahag: LEDGER_TOKEN5=f8790

Finance team reference. Corvel Standard holds at current list; Corvel Plus rises 6% from next quarter. Discount ceiling: 12% without VP sign-off. Bundle pricing with the Marrow add-on stays frozen pending the channel review. Margin floor per unit remains unchanged. Do not circulate figures outside this group. Quarterly repricing cadence continues; exceptions route through the pricing desk. Regional uplifts for the Ostermark territory apply from the first of the month. The confidential pricing strategy note appears below.

internal memo for kawip-hadug: Headcount on the Wenwyn team goes from 7 to 140 by the end of January. Gross margin on Wenwyn came in at 20 percent against a plan of 15 percent.